What hail does to a roof in Fort Worth
Hail break is just not always the dramatic crater pattern that reveals up in pix. Most asphalt shingles fail in quieter methods. The have an impact on fractures the mat and dislodges granules, exposing the bitumen to UV. Water intrudes microscopically, the bond weakens, and months later you've got you have got a curling tab or a leak on the decking seam. I actually have noticed hail create spider-cyber web cracking you can only see from a scan rectangular chalked on a south-going through slope. On 3-tab shingles, the bruising looks like mushy berries lower than the surface. Architectural shingles disguise it better, but hidden does no longer suggest innocent.
Across neighborhoods like Ridglea Hills and Meadows West, roofs that face due west take a beating whilst storms sweep across I‑20 and I‑30. Gusts from squall traces can push hail at a shallow angle, which pries at shingle edges and exploits nail placement. If a workforce hit top nails once they established your last roof, wind-pushed hail will in finding it. Ridge caps and hips are standard vulnerable aspects, as are metallic flashings at chimneys in older Mistletoe Heights properties the place mortar is already fatigued.
What “hail-resistant” simply means
Contractors and brands throw around rankings that sound technical. Here is the one to care about: UL 2218 influence rating. Class 4 is the upper score on that scale. In Fort Worth, an upgrade to Class four shingles often will pay for itself by way of decreased insurance plan premiums over five to seven years, equipped your service deals the bargain and also you keep the coverage. Beyond the lab scan, you need to look at the shingle’s reinforcement, adhesive strip, and the way it behaves in warmness. A Class 4 shingle that gets gummy at 102 tiers on a July afternoon in Grapevine is absolutely not your family member.
Impact-resistant picks fall into just a few camps: polymer-changed asphalt shingles with SBS or comparable components, rubberized shingle composites, stone-coated steel approaches, and metallic panels like status seam. The alternate-offs count. Stone-covered metallic laughs at hail but will likely be noisy in a onerous rain if the underlayment is inaccurate. Standing seam sheds hail beautifully and handles sizzling roofs close to the Cultural District’s sunbaked lots, but denting and aesthetic issues depend in upscale regions like TCU/Westcliff. The stronger Class four asphalt shingles hit a great midsection ground for so much of Fort Worth, balancing have an effect on resistance, expense, and neighborhood seem, principally in which HOA guidelines steer aesthetics.
The contractor’s function in surely performance
Even a excellent-rated shingle fails early if the install is sloppy. Fastener placement, deck fix, and ventilation check whether or not a hail-resistant roof plays to spec. I even have inspected roofs on the Near Southside that failed upfront on the grounds that the group drove nails at an angle, tearing the mat https://telegra.ph/Storm-Damage-Roof-Repair-in-Fort-Worth-Veteran-Brothers-Roofing--Restoration-Can-Help-10-13 ahead of hail ever hit. Another ordinary hindrance: skip-sheathing or degraded decking in 1960s ranch buildings north of Camp Bowie. If your roof artisan does not re-deck or patch wisely, effect hundreds deal with voids and end in cracks along seams.
Ventilation isn't always glamorous but issues for those who park a darker, thicker shingle over a poorly vented attic. Heat a while asphalt. In neighborhoods like Keller and Park Glen, in which gable ends are average, your contractor could balance intake and exhaust, no longer simply slap on container vents and contact it finished. For low-slope components round dormers, use self-adhered underlayments with prime temperature scores and right kind ice and water membranes to face up to wind-pushed rain. These judgements are the difference among a roof that shrugs off a May hailstorm and person who leaks down a loo vent stack.

Installation info that separate execs from pretenders
I still see contractors who installation to the minimum, then lean at the shingle’s rating to make up the change. That is backward. The shingle is the high layer of a approach. A reroof contractor will have to plan from the deck up. Replace delicate decking. Use cap nails on underlayment to stay clear of tear-outs in top winds. Reinforce valleys with steel or double underlayment, no longer simply woven shingles. At eaves going through south over West seventh, I select a wider drip facet to preserve fascia from sunlight and splashback. Around chimneys and skylights, insist on new flashings, no longer paint and caulk over previous metallic. I actually have fastened greater leaks from reused flashings than from any single hailstone.
Fastener counts sound tedious, yet they be counted. Many Class 4 merchandise specify six nails per shingle for high-wind zones. Err at the prime edge while your place sits on a ridge, like areas above Marine Creek. Nail into the strengthened strip, flush, now not angled. These small choices upload years to a roof.

Costs, alternate-offs, and return on investment
A Class four asphalt roof probably expenditures greater than a baseline architectural roof, in certain cases by using 10 to 25 % relying at the product and the complexity of your roof. Stone-coated metallic or standing seam climb greater. Offsetting motives embody practicable insurance coverage mark downs, longer provider life, and fewer disruptive repairs over the years. In neighborhoods that see repeat hail each and every few years, the ROI in most cases advice in choose of Class 4 within one coverage cycle, exceedingly while you plan to dangle the belongings for five to 10 years.

A be aware on warranties one could easily use
Manufacturer warranties for effect-resistant shingles usually require real air flow and set up to stay legitimate. Some provide beauty insurance plan, others do not. Read the nice print, and feature your contractor positioned their workmanship guarantee in writing, with a term that matches native principles, usually 5 to ten years for hard work on complete replacements.
